Bio

Born in Brisbane Australia, James began his film journey early in life, picking up his first camera at the age of 11 and falling in love with photography  first, then the magic of motion images. He continued his passion through his schooling, before attending film school at Queensland University of Technology.

 

James began his career working on Chanel 7's Home & Away, as well as creating short narrative films, documentaries and music videos, working as a news camera operator for WIN News, Ten News then Nine News, before moving on and working with the Australian Supercars Championship's in house broadcast and media department.

 

Now, James is dedicated to creating outstanding motion images and industry leading engaging screen-based content with creativity, precision and authenticity, as well as nurturing the artists of the future.

ENVOY: Shark Cull

Over 2019-2021 James was fortunate to work with The Hype Project as Cinematographer and Editor on Envoy: Shark Cull is a feature-length documentary, narrated by Eric Bana which follows some of the biggest names in ocean conservation, such as Sea Shepherd, Ocean Ramsey and Madison Stewart. We will join these experts as they explore and expose this scarcely understood topic.
